Background This presolicitation pertains to the Turbine Guide Bearing Pumps for the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ers, Walla Walla District, at Dworshak Dam. The goal of the contract is to supply specific pumps required for the operation of the dam. This will be a firm-fixed-price supply contract, and it is designated as a Total Small Business Set Aside. Work Details The contractor is required to supply the following items under the contract: - **CLIN 0001**: Three (3) Unit 1 & 2 Pumps – AC, with associated adapting components. - **CLIN 0002**: Two (2) Unit 1 & 2 Pumps – DC, with associated adapting components. - **CLIN 0003**: Two (2) Unit 3 Pumps – AC, with associated adapting components. - **CLIN 0004**: One (1) Unit 3 Pump – DC, with associated adapting components. **Technical Specifications**: - The pumps must be three-screw positive displacement rotary type with specified flow rates and materials: - For Units 1 & 2 AC Pumps: Flow rate of 9 gallons per minute at 75 PSI; inlet size of 1.5” NPT and outlet size of 1” NPT. - For Units 3 AC Pumps: Flow rate of 24 gallons per minute at 75 PSI; inlet size of 2” NPT and outlet size of 1.5” NPT. - All pumps must be constructed from new materials without excessive corrosion and must not be modified beyond optional items. - The contractor must provide mechanical seals, adaptors for motor connections, jaw-style couplings, and ensure all components are OSHA compliant. Period of Performance All items must be delivered FOB to Dworshak Dam on or before June 15th, 2026. Place of Performance Dworshak Dam and Reservoir (Dworshak Project), Ahsahka, Idaho.
